GIA’s “Retailer Lookup” Gains Popularity; 7,500 Retailers Registered So Far

Consumers looking for assurance and quality when shopping for diamonds, have one more tool to guide them. GIA’s “Retailer Lookup” is now available to help them search for retailers stocking GIA (Gemological Institute of America) graded diamonds and stores with GIA educated staff by city or postal code; and provides information like addresses, store hours and directions for registered stores.

This has enabled retailers round the world to get noticed by shoppers. So far, GIA said, its Retailer Lookup has 7,500 registered doors and still counting.

“So far, in 2017 we’ve seen a more than 300% increase in the number of consumers using the Lookup to find retailers, which demonstrates the appeal of GIA reports and expertise,” said Tali Nay, manager of GIA’s Retailer Support Program. “GIA’s Retailer Lookup is a great way for the gem and jewellery buying public to find retail jewellery stores carrying diamonds graded by GIA or employing GIA-trained staff.”

GIA said that over the past two years the number of registered retailers has gone up by 60%. Presently, about 42% of the participating stores are outside the U.S.

“The Retailer Lookup is part of GIA’s Retailer Support Program that provides resources for retailers to help sales staff educate consumers about the 4Cs of diamond quality and the value of a GIA report,” GIA elaborated. “As part of GIA’s effort to ensure the public trust in gems and jewellery, the Retailer Support Program offers stores large and small an array of materials to help them educate their customers.”

As part of the programme, retailers have access to a number of tools to support their diamond sales which include authorised GIA signage, educational counter displays and brochures to bring authoritative GIA information about diamonds, coloured stones and pearls into the conversation at the counter. The programme also provides free videos, images, logos and interactive downloads that can be used in advertising, and on a retailer’s website and social media pages, GIA explained. What is more, the Retailer Support Program offers retailers training resources, including a series of training modules for their staff.

“We are proud to be part of GIA’s Retailer Support Program and have our name listed on the GIA website,” said Jonathan Goldberg, President and CEO of Kimberfire. “The Retailer Lookup is a valuable tool – it has opened up our customer network and helped us connect with those looking for a jeweller with our high standards, focus on quality and transparency. We are very excited about the potential for this tool to help us reach new customers and grow our brand.”
